Job description

At Ambitious about Autism, we're currently looking for a Head of Governance and Compliance to join our team.

You'll play a crucial role, ensuring best practice governance and compliance is embedded in Ambitious about Autism and the Ambitious about Autism Schools Trust. You'll develop and implement high-quality monitoring and reporting policies and systems, promoting excellent governance and maintaining compliance with all external regulatory requirements.

You'll work closely with colleagues in the Executive Teams and wider Senior Management Team, as well as ensuring the Board is meeting its responsibilities and receiving high quality information and support from the staff team. You'll also contribute to the development of the organisation's overall strategy and operational plan, as a member of the Senior Management Team.

We are looking for someone who has:

  • Demonstrable experience in managing the governance of an organisation.
  • Up to date knowledge of either or both of Charity Commission, Care Quality Commission and Department for Education regulatory environments.
  • Proven knowledge and experience in governance and compliance, working at a senior level with Trustees and senior leaders.
  • In depth knowledge of statutory reporting procedures and record keeping.
